Sékou Baradji (born 30 August 1995) is a French professional footballer who plays as a forward for RC Grasse.

Career[]

Baradji was in the youth system of US Cergy Clos from the age of 8 until 2012. He then trialled with Elche and signed a contract with the Under-19s. He returned to France after three months to complete his education, joining the Under-19 sides of L'Entente SSG and then Racing CFF.[1][2][3]

A knee injury sidelined him for 8 months, but he joined at level ten in the Franch football pyramid in January 2015, when contacted by a coach he had worked under at Racing CFF. He scored 15 goals in four months, and earned a move four levels up the pyramid to , where he was top scorer in Division d'Honneur with 18 goals in 20 matches.[1][2][3]

For the 2016–17 season, Baradji signed with Boulogne-Billancourt in Championnat National 2. After another good season he was signed by Red Star in June 2017.[2]

At the end of December 2018, Baradji was loaned to Bourg-Péronnas until the end of the 2018–19 season, due to limited first team opportunities at Red Star.[4]

In August 2020, Baradji left Red Star by mutual agreement.[5] Before the end of the same month he signed with RC Grasse.[6]
